"Oracle Concepts (10g R2) 中文版_V11.pdf"
Oracle数据库是世界上最广泛使用的数据库管理系统之一,尤其在企业级应用中占据主导地位。《Oracle Concepts (10g R2) 中文版》是Oracle公司发布的官方文档,旨在帮助用户理解和掌握Oracle数据库的基本概念和架构。该文档共分为两大部分,详细介绍了Oracle数据库的核心要素。
第一部分“何为Oracle?”涵盖了Oracle数据库的基础知识,包括第1章“Oracle数据库简介”。这一章节通常会介绍Oracle数据库的历史、功能、主要特性以及它在数据库管理系统中的地位。读者可以从中了解到Oracle数据库是如何支持企业级数据存储、管理和访问的。
第二部分“Oracle数据库体系结构”深入解析了Oracle数据库的内部运作机制。第2章“数据块,数据扩展,及数据段”讲解了Oracle如何组织和存储数据,包括数据块作为基本存储单位,数据扩展如何提供连续的存储空间,以及数据段如何将逻辑数据结构映射到物理存储上。第3章“表空间,数据文件,及控制文件”讨论了数据在磁盘上的组织方式,表空间的逻辑概念,以及数据文件和控制文件在数据库管理中的作用。第4章“事务管理”涉及数据库事务的ACID属性(原子性、一致性、隔离性和持久性),以及回滚和提交等概念。第5章至第7章分别阐述了“方案对象”、“方案对象间的依赖关系”以及“数据字典”,解释了对象如表、视图、索引的创建和管理,以及对象间的依赖关系和元数据的存储。第8章“内存体系结构”则涵盖了Oracle数据库的SGA(System Global Area)和PGA(Program Global Area),解释了内存如何在数据库操作中发挥作用。最后,第9章及后续章节可能会继续讨论数据库的其他关键组件,如进程、备份与恢复策略、安全性、性能优化等方面的内容。
这个中文版文档对于初学者来说是非常宝贵的资源,因为它用简明易懂的语言解释了复杂的Oracle数据库概念,同时也适合有经验的DBA进行参考。值得注意的是,该文档可能已经过时,因为Oracle数据库目前已经发展到了更高的版本,但其基础原理和核心概念依然适用。尽管如此,理解这些基本概念对于理解更高级的特性和技术至关重要。